A shocking display of diplomatic blundering has emerged in Turkey, where UK Labour Party leader Keir Starmer was gifted a gun and ammunition by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an during a NATO meeting. The weapon, which has not been returned to the UK, has instead been left in Turkey with British officials, sparking concerns over the security and proper accounting of the firearm.

The incident has raised eyebrows among politicians, law enforcement officials, and security experts, who question the rationale behind the gift and subsequent decision to leave the firearm in Turkey. Critics argue that this move disregards British firearm regulations and raises concerns about the potential for unsecured and unaccounted weapons being introduced into sensitive environments.

While Erdogan's motivations behind the gift remain unclear, analysts argue that the move may have been an attempt to assert Turkish influence and dominance in international affairs. However, the diplomatic fallout from this incident is likely to be significant, with many calling for greater transparency and accountability in international gift-giving practices.

As the situation continues to unfold, it remains to be seen whether a formal investigation will be launched to assess the circumstances surrounding the gift and subsequent decision to leave the firearm in Turkey. One thing, however, is clear: the presence of unaccounted firearms raises significant security implications for British authorities and citizens alike.
